Pot Scrubbers

I started using my own pot scrubbers everywhere in my kitchen lately not just for pots.  I know, I've been making them for everyone else but I still was using a stanky sponge myself.

I LOVE them. I'm using them for dishes, cleaning the counters, and wiping down the stove. I decided I want a clean one for every day of the week plus one extra in case I have a lazy laundry week.

Just like with my face scrubbies I needed to keep them close and yet pretty so I went to work on a basket to hold them all.This one is a nice blue stripe with a square bottom. I really liked the way the rolled over cuff looks plus it adds some strength to hold the basket to shape without needed to starch it.


I don't know if the stitch I used on the scrubbers is one already out there but I had a 'ah ha' moment and combined 2 different stitches to make them thick and nubby at the same time. They are a single layer unlike most of the other patterns I found that sew 2 layers of crochet together. I may share the stitch eventually but waiting for a little feedback from testers first. The scrubbers are thick and work nicely for me.
